Il arrive parfois qu’un internaute soit redirigé vers une autre page que celle prévue initialement…

C’est ce que vous allez découvrir dans cet article, plus précisément le terme “redirection” !

Pour commencer, voici sa définition d’un point de vue expert :

Une pratique couramment utilisée en SEO est la redirection d’URL. Elle a pour objectif de rediriger automatiquement les internautes arrivés sur une page vers une autre page du site Web.

Laurent m’a expliqué son utilité ce matin, en prenant un café à la cafétéria.

Pour en savoir plus, lisez cet article !

Ma définition de la redirection

La redirection, ou “redirect” en anglais, est surtout utilisée en cas de refonte d’un site Internet pour éviter les erreurs 404.

Vous pouvez rediriger une URL, côté serveur ou côté client.

Côté serveur, vous avez le choix entre :

  • La redirection 301 pour retransmettre l’adresse URL de la nouvelle page,
  • La redirection 302 pour rediriger en permanence des pages de la version HTTP 1.0,
  • Et la redirection 307 mettre en place des redirections temporaires…

La redirection côté client, quant à elle, comprend :

  • La redirection JavaScript qui demande au navigateur de charger une autre URL via du code JavaScript,
  • La Meta refresh qui indique au navigateur de rediriger l’internaute vers une autre URL ou de rafraîchir la page Web après un certain délai.

Ryte souligne que l’utilisateur est automatiquement redirigé et en général s’en aperçoit rarement.

À quoi ça sert une redirection d’URL ?

Elle peut être utilisée dans plusieurs situations :

  • Maintenance du serveur,
  • Changement de nom de domaine,
  • Refonte d’un site Web,
  • Modification d’une URL,
  • Accès à une même page Web via des liens différents,
  • Accès à un site multilingue,
  • Présence de duplicate content,
  • Liens morts ou cassés,
  • Déplacer une page dans un autre répertoire du site,
  • Relance d’un site Internet…

Note : sachez qu’utiliser trop de redirections inutiles peut affecter les performances le site Web de votre entreprise.

Comment faire pour créer une redirection 301 ?

Pour rediriger en 301, mieux vaut effectuer un changement au niveau du serveur. C’est-à-dire directement dans le fichier .htaccess, situé à la racine du site Web et qui ne contient que du texte.

Voici quelques instructions parmi les plus courantes :

1. Pour rediriger une seule page

RedirectPermanent /dossier/ancienne-page https://www.votresite.com/nouvelle-page

2. Pour rediriger un répertoire

RedirectPermanent /ancien-repertoire https://www.www.votresite.com/nouveau-repertoire

3. Pour rediriger vers un nouveau domaine

RedirectPermanent / https://www.nouveau-domaine.com/

Note : le redirect 301 est le plus utilisé en termes de SEO. C’est le cas, entre lors d’un  changement de nom de domaine, afin de garder la popularité transmise par les backlinks.

Mon conseil : sous WordPress, je vous recommande d’utiliser l’extension WordPress “redirection”.